系统功能与验收测试关键点解析

需积分: 10 0 下载量 13 浏览量 更新于2024-08-13 收藏 770KB PPT 举报
本文主要探讨了可安装性测试和系统功能测试在软件测试中的重要性,特别是关注于安装过程的各个关键环节以及功能测试的各个方面。 在可安装性测试中,首要任务是确保软件能够成功安装所有必需的文件和数据,并进行必要的系统设置。测试人员需要检查安装过程中是否有明确、友好的提示信息,以及是否对安装环境有明确的要求。安装程序不应占用过多系统资源或引发与原系统冲突的问题,同时应保证软件安装的完整性和灵活性。许可证或注册号码的验证也是安装测试的一部分,以确保软件授权的合法性。此外,升级安装后的兼容性测试也很重要,要验证原有程序是否能正常运行。卸载测试同样不容忽视,需确认软件能够干净地卸载,不会留下残留文件或影响系统功能。 系统功能测试是软件测试的核心环节,其目的是验证软件是否满足预定的功能需求。这包括界面的测试,如程序启动、提示框和错误提示的正常运作;功能的符合性,确保每个功能都能按照预期工作;界面的美观和易用性;操作的灵活性和异常处理能力;数据输入和输出的正确性,包括对异常数据的容错处理;逻辑流程的清晰度,以及是否符合用户习惯;系统状态的稳定性;对不同环境和硬件设备的支持;旧版本数据的兼容性;以及与其他外部应用系统的接口有效性。 以WEB功能测试为例,测试人员会关注页面链接的有效性,确保页面能正确显示和跳转;图像的正确显示,包括图文混排的合理性,图片的链接和内容的准确性,以及在不同分辨率下的表现;此外,还有表单测试,涉及表单的填写、提交、验证以及后台处理用户输入信息的能力。 可安装性测试和系统功能测试是保障软件质量的关键步骤,它们涵盖了一系列细节,旨在确保软件能够在目标环境中顺利运行,满足用户需求,并提供稳定、安全的用户体验。全面的测试策略对于软件产品的成功至关重要。